unsloth-cli

Agent + CLI that simplifies fine-tuning with Unsloth, adding complementary actions so an agent can fine-tune models more easily.

What you get

  • An agent-first CLI cited from teken (afi-cli) — the runtime package has no third-party dependencies.
  • A mesh identityculture.yaml (suffix + backend) and the matching prompt file (CLAUDE.md for backend: claude).
  • The canonical guildmaster skill kit (11 skills) under .claude/skills/, vendored cite-don't-import. See docs/skill-sources.md.
  • A build + deploy baseline — pytest, lint, the agent-first rubric gate, and PyPI Trusted Publishing wired into GitHub Actions.

Quickstart

uv sync
uv run pytest -n auto                 # run the test suite
uv run sloth whoami                   # identity from culture.yaml
uv run sloth learn                    # self-teaching prompt (add --json)
uv run teken cli doctor . --strict    # the agent-first rubric gate CI runs

The installed console script is sloth (the dist name is unsloth-cli); run sloth <verb> or python -m sloth <verb>. The CLI prints unsloth-cli in its help/explain text because that is the argparse program name.

CLI

Verb What it does
whoami Report this agent's nick, version, backend, and model from culture.yaml.
learn Print a structured self-teaching prompt.
explain <path> Markdown docs for any noun/verb path.
overview Read-only descriptive snapshot of the agent.
doctor Check the agent-identity invariants (prompt-file-present, backend-consistency).
cli overview Describe the CLI surface itself.

Every command supports --json. Results go to stdout, errors/diagnostics to stderr (never mixed). Exit codes: 0 success, 1 user error, 2 environment error, 3+ reserved.

Make it your own

  1. Rename the package sloth/ and the unsloth-cli CLI/dist name throughout pyproject.toml, the package, tests/, sonar-project.properties, and this README.md. The name is hard-coded in ~100 places, so list every occurrence first — see the git grep discovery command in CLAUDE.md, the authoritative rename procedure.
  2. Edit culture.yaml with your suffix and backend.
  3. Rewrite CLAUDE.md for your agent and run /init.
  4. Re-vendor only the skills you need from guildmaster (see docs/skill-sources.md).

See CLAUDE.md for the full conventions (version-bump-every-PR, the cicd PR lane, deploy setup).
